#58834c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#58834c is composed of 34.5% red, 51.4%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 42%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 106.9 degrees, a saturation of 26.6% and a lightness of 40.6%. #58834c color hex could be obtained by blending #b0ff98 with #000700.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

● #58834c color description : Mostly desaturated dark lime green.
#58834c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#58834c has RGB values of R:88, G:131,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0.33, M:0, Y:0.42,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 5800780.

Shades and Tints of #58834c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050704 is the darkest color, while #fafcf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#58834c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#656b64 is the less saturated color, while #30cb04 is the most saturated one.
